Ebenezer Kitchen
Going back to 2023, Ebenezer Kitchen has four inspections in the public record. The latest inspection on file is from Mar 23, 2026. When a facility lands in the low risk tier, it usually means nothing alarming showed up at the most recent visit.
Recent inspections have turned up more issues than earlier ones, averaging around two violations lately compared to roughly zero violations before.
When inspectors have written things up, “no probe thermometer provided to measure temperature” has been the most frequent reason, cited two times.
Compared to the broader Miami restaurant scene, where the average is 74, this is a stronger showing. Nothing in the record is alarming, but there's room to improve.
